From: Structural reorganization of the early visual cortex following Braille training in sighted adults

Tactile Braille training induces white matter reorganization in the peripheral early visual cortex. (a) Fractional anisotropy (FA) changes in the experimental group, following the tactile Braille training. (b) Individual subjects’ FA changes in the early visual cluster depicted in (a). (c) Centres of gravity (COG) of white matter and grey matter reorganization in the early visual cortex. White matter and grey matter changes are depicted in blue and red respectively. The COGs are illustrated as 6 mm spheres. (d) The results of ROI analysis in the early visual cortex. Thresholds: (a) p < 0.001, corrected for multiple comparisons using a cluster extent of p < 0.05. Results have been thickened for visualization purposes using the standard tbss_fill FSL command, and overlaid on the subjects’ mean FA skeleton (d) ***p < 0.001; **p < 0.01; *p < 0.05. The dotted line denotes a time x group interaction. Error bars represent standard error of the mean.
